Pizza Bouquet

Small counter-service restaurant popular for its New York-style pizzas, both whole and by the slice, available to eat in or take away.

Review Summary

Pizza Bouquet serves classic New York style pizza in a small, no-frills spot where the crust is crisp, the dough is light, and the sauce and toppings are well balanced, with several reviewers calling it the best slice in Montreal and noting affordable prices and quick service. The vibe is casual and unfussy, with friendly staff and a steady flow of fresh slices, including standout variations like potato, sopressata and cherry bomb, though some guests mention occasional inconsistencies in doneness and slower counter service during busy times, and a wish for more sustainable plates. Overall, Pizza Bouquet comes across as a reliable go-to for authentic NY flavor, with generous portions and good value that keep people coming back.

Being from NY I always look for the best pizza places when I'm somewhere else. This pie was very good! I'd say the flavor was the best part, the toppings balanced each other well, the sauce was tasty, & the finishing grated cheese added a nice flavor. The dough tasted very bready in a good way, but texture wise wasn't too bready. The one somewhat negative thing I will say is that I wish they let it cook for another minute, was lacking a bit of crisp/crunch. It seems their pizza doneness are somewhat inconsistent. The pizza's they were selling for slices had a range of how cooked they were, some that looked like mine & some cooked a bit longer like I would have wanted my pie to be. But overall very solid.

This is a place i have mixed feelings about. I have been pretty often, maybe 20-25 times over the last 2 years. On one hand, it can be one of the best slice counter in the city; but it's not saying much, giving the poor level of slices in Montréal. However, on a good day, a fresh slice is usually quite satisfying. The dough is slightly too hard & thick, & the amount of toppings is slighlty too little for that style, so each bite doesn't have the correct balance, can feel pretty dry. Still, it feels like it's made with good ingredients & some love - which is better than 90% of Mtl pizza. Cherry Bomb is a stand out for me.

Now the big problem is the service at the front counter. Service is a lost art in Montreal, & that place is no exception. Slow, nonchalant, cynical attitude, usually by someone with neglected hygiene & looking mildly depressed (last time i went, the counter person was wearing some ironic vintage cap crusted with black dirt, & not from working in the kitchen, it's concerning). Consistent with that anglo hipster-gentrified part of town, serving in french seems to be low on priorities, so if you're a francophone, expect a sort of panic reaction if you address in french. That could be forgiven easily with the right attitude, but with that careless, sloppy energy, it's off-putting.
Pies are not identified on the front counter slice tray, which means each new customer will ask which pizza is which. The clerk will answer with the most annoyed, blasé expression & voice, since they've likely been repeating the same info all day.

All in all, a good spot, but one which could be way better.

3 stars until the service attitude & hygiene gets better!
